dictionary-en.com Free online language dictionary.

vantage in russian

Word:
vantage (Number of letters: 7)
Dictionary:
english-russian
Translations (6):
власть, господство, перевес, превосходство, преимущество, преобладание
Related words:
russian vantage, vantage weather, vantage toyota york, vantage toyota, vantage recruitment, vantage point, vantage in russian, власть in english
vantage in russian